html5canvas畫扇形的簡單介紹
新建html5canvas文檔和新建as3文檔區(qū)別是1功能和用途HTML5Canvas提供了豐富的2D繪圖功能,可以繪制圖形文本圖像,以及進行動畫和交互AS3則具有更強大的功能,除了2D繪圖外,還支持3D渲染多媒體處理網絡通信等。
為了用DOM做2D游戲,你基本上要動態(tài)地調整元素風格,以便在頁面上移動它雖然有些時候DOM修改是很好的,但這一次我將重點介紹使用HTML5Canvas來制作圖像,因為對于現(xiàn)代瀏覽器,它是最靈活的頁面設置首先,你要創(chuàng)建一個HTML。
在Html5Canvas中,有幾種方法可以清除屏幕 有兩種方法可以擦除畫布ClearRect方法 重置高度寬度 示例*本示例使用jQuery描述* varcanvas=$#myCanvas選擇要擦除的畫布元素 varcontext=canvasget0getcontext2d。
html5canvas怎么畫 什么是Canvas?HTML5ltcanvas元素用于圖形的繪制,通過腳本通常是JavaScript來完成ltcanvas標簽只是圖形容器,您必須使用腳本來繪制圖形你可以通過多種方法使用Canva繪制路徑,盒圓字符以及添加圖像創(chuàng)建。
本申請涉及動畫領域,具體而言,涉及一種基于Canvas的動畫播放速度調整方法及裝置背景技術目前,在使用HTML5Canvas繪制動畫的過程時,會使用動畫幀繪制技術,將每一幀按照一定順序串聯(lián)起來播放,只要幀播放速度合適,就可以創(chuàng)建一個流暢的動畫。
主要思想\x0d\x0a首先要準備一張有連續(xù)幀的圖片,然后利用HTML5Canvas的draw方法在不同的時間間隔繪制不同的幀,這樣看起來就像動畫在播放\x0d\x0a關鍵技術點\x0d\x0aJavaScript函數setTimeout有兩個參數。
上面的不行,是因為這2個對象沒有初始化,就調用方法,報錯,可以這樣寫 windowonload = function canvas = documentgetElementByIdquotmyCanvasquotcontext = canvasgetContextquot2dquotcontextrect20,20,150。
掃描二維碼推送至手機訪問。
版權聲明:本文由飛速云SEO網絡優(yōu)化推廣發(fā)布,如需轉載請注明出處。